Facing Catastrophe: A Guide to Catastrophe Response

Disasters may occur with little warning, leaving individuals and communities exposed. Effective catastrophe response requires a blend of preparation and decisive response. Start by creating a comprehensive emergency plan that covers potential hazards, evacuation routes, and communication strategies. Assemble an emergency bag stocked with essential supplies, including water, food, first-aid supplies, and tools. Stay informed about local weather patterns and alerts. During a disaster, prioritize well-being by seeking shelter, following evacuation orders, and minimizing exposure to danger. Cooperate with emergency responders and assist your neighbors when possible.

  • Locate reliable information from trusted officials
  • Stay calm and assess the situation
  • Follow official instructions and evacuation orders

From Crisis to Recovery

Effective disaster management involves a integrated approach that encompasses preparedness, response, and recovery stages. During the initial crisis phase, swift activation of emergency plans is crucial to minimize loss. Establishing clear channels between stakeholders, including government agencies, first responders, and the affected community, is essential for a coordinated response.

Following the immediate crisis, recovery efforts focus on restoring critical services, providing assistance to displaced individuals, and restoring infrastructure. Long-term recovery strategies aim to enhance preparedness by fortifying community capacities and implementing measures to mitigate the impact of future disasters.

A key element of effective disaster management is continuous evaluation to identify lessons learned and refine strategies for improved performance in subsequent events.
